Transatlantic take on Horsham life

AN ONLINE writer from Horsham, known for his witty take on life in the UK, has had his first book published.

Michael Harling, 54, moved here from the US in 2002, and has been entertaining internet audiences with his wry observations about Britain ever since.

Many more of his thoughts are now available in print as Postcards From Across the Pond – Dispatches From an Accidental Expat.

Although frequently amused – or just baffled – by the British way of life, Michael has an obvious fondness for his adoptive country and its people's habits.

Commenting on a rainy afternoon at a Brighton and Hove Albion game – his first experience of a live 'soccer' match – he writes:

'If an American finds himself sitting in the rain watching a ball game, he'll build a covered stadium – complete with Astroturf, artificial lighting and climate control – and then sit there feeling superior because he's conquered the weather.

'When a Brit finds himself sitting in the rain, he zips his waterproof, puts on a cap and feels virtuous because he can cope with the weather without undertaking a major construction project.

'It's one of the prime differences between America and the rest of the world, and I happen to like this way better; Americans spend far too much time in artificial environments.'

Mr Harling told the County Times: "Everything's different here – that's what the book is about."

Mr Harling will be signing copies of his book tomorrow (Saturday February 21) at Waterstone's in the Carfax, Horsham, between 11am and 2pm.
